Japan marks fifth anniversary of devastating earthquake and Tsunami that killed thousands

Japan is marking the fifth anniversary of the devastating earthquake and tsunami that left more than 18,000 people dead or missing.

At 2.46pm local time (5.46am), the moment the quake hit, bells rang out across Tokyo and people around the nation bowed their heads in a moment of silence.

Emperor Akihito and Prime Minister Shinzo Abe led a ceremony attended by 12,000 people, bowing in front of a stage laden with white and yellow flowers.

It included survivors from the northeast coastal region of the country, which was virtually wiped out by the tsunami.


A total of 15,894 people are confirmed to have died in the disaster, with 2,562 more unaccounted for. Another 340,000 people were displaced from their homes.

Figures released last year revealed that some 170,000 people remain stuck in temporary accommodation along the worst hit parts of the coast.

The earthquake also triggered the world's worst nuclear disaster since Chernobyl in 1986, crippling the Fukushima nuclear plant.

Meltdowns in three reactors leaked radiation over a wide area of the countryside, contaminating water, food and air.

Some areas remain no-go zones due to high radiation.

The nine-magnitude quake struck offshore,creating a tsunami that swept across the coastline.Naoto Kan, the Prime Minister at the time, has said he feared he would have to evacuate Tokyo and that Japan's very existence could have been in peril.

The current Prime Minister, Shinzo Abe said the five years had been days of hardship and pain for those affected by the disaster, but he has promised enough money to help people in the worst-hit areas rebuild their lives.

Lekki Building Collapse Update: Lekki Gardens MD Detained, To Be Prosecuted

Richard Nyong, MD Lekki Gardens collapsed building
Richard Nyong, MD Lekki Gardens
The Lagos State Police Command confirmed today that they had arrested Richard Nyong, the Managing Director and Chief Executive Officer of Lekki Gardens, a construction company handling the construction of a five-story building that collapsed last Tuesday in Lekki, Lagos State. 

The death toll from the collapsed building, located on Kushenla Road, Ikate Elegushi in Lekki on Tuesday, has reached 31, according to one state official. 

A police spokesperson, Dolapo Badmos, disclosed that Mr. Nyong has been detained at Panti Police Station. Ms. Badmos added that the construction firm’s MD would be charged to court as early as tomorrow as investigations are almost completed.

On Wednesday, Governor Akinwunmi Ambode of Lagos State had ordered all directors of Lekki Worldwide Estate Limited to submit themselves to the Lagos State Commissioner of Police, Mr. Fatai Owoseni, within twenty-four hours or face arrest.

In compliance with the governor’s directive, Mr. Nyong reported himself to the office of the Commissioner of Police in the company of his lawyer, Mr. Wole Olanipekun. The police then detained him after an initial interrogation. 

Following the collapse of the building, the Lagos State Government revealed that preliminary investigations indicated that state officials had issued a violation notice on the building for exceeding the number of approved floors. 

The state added that the building was thereafter sealed by the Lagos State Building Control Agency.

The government stated that, in a brazen act of defiance and impunity, the owners of the building, Messrs Lekki Worldwide Estate Limited, the promoters of Lekki Gardens, criminally unsealed the property and continued building beyond the approved floors until the tragic collapse that has claimed the lives of more than 30 people.

A state official told SaharaReporters that Governor Ambode was furious at the number of collapsed buildings in the state, adding that the governor was determined “to wield the big stick so as to put a stop to the disturbing trend.”

Lekki Building Collapse: Death Toll Rises To 30

Lekki Building Collapse: Death Toll Rises To 30
“We have so far recovered 30 corpses and the number of those rescued alive still stands at 13,”Ibrahim Farinloye, from the National Emergency Management Agency (NEMA), told AFP.

A total of 12 bodies were recovered since rescuers resumed work Wednesday morning, he added.

The fatal collapse happened after heavy rains in the early hours of Tuesday in the southeastern district of Lekki, which is home to some of the most expensive real estate in the city.

Lekki, made up of sprawling estates of gated communities of US-style suburban homes, has developed rapidly in recent years into a preferred location for wealthier Nigerians and expatriates.
Some detached houses can sell for millions of dollars.

Building collapses happen frequently in densely populated areas of Lagos, which is home to some 20 million people. Poor workmanship and materials, and a lack of official oversight are often blamed.
But collapses are rarer in wealthier districts.

The Lagos State government said in a statement that preliminary reports indicated work on the building was illegal but the order had been flouted.

–‘Brazen act of defiance’–
“The collapsed building was served (a) contravention notice for exceeding the approved floors”and was sealed by the Lagos State Building Control Agency, it added.
The owners of the building and promoters of the Lekki Gardens development, Lekki Worldwide Estate Limited,“criminally unsealed the property and continued building beyond the approved floors”.

The government called the owners’actions“a brazen act of defiance and impunity”and said“integrity tests”should be conducted on all projects being handled by the company.

All work has been ordered to stop at the site and the owners told to report to the police within 24 hours or face arrest, Lagos State information commissioner Steve Ayorinde said.

“The State Government will no longer tolerate the action(s) of unscrupulous owners and builders who challenge its supervisory control thereby endangering the lives of Lagosians,”he added.

“The State Government has consequently directed the suspension of work at the site and ordered the Lagos State Police Command to cordon it off as it is now a crime scene.”

Lekki Gardens confirmed in a statement that construction had stopped in January“over reported structural defects”but made no mention of work having resumed.

It added:“Investigation is already under way to ascertain the identities of those affected as it is not company policy for site workers to take shelter in uncompleted buildings.”

The addition of floors without proper planning approval was ruled to have been a factor in the collapse of a church guesthouse in Lagos in September 2014.

A total of 116 people were killed, 81 of them South Africans, in the collapse at the Synagogue Church of All Nations complex of popular evangelical preacher TB Joshua.
Joshua, church trustees and two engineers are currently on trial for criminal negligence and involuntary manslaughter.

Abacha Loot: Switzerland Ready To Release Another $321 Million Abacha Loot To Nigeria

Switzerland Ready To Release Another $321 Million Abacha Loot  To Nigeria
Late General Sani Abacha 
Nigeria and Switzerland on Tuesday in Abuja signed a letter of intent for the repatriation of illicit assets, including the 321 million dollars allegedly stashed in Swiss banks by late Gen. Sani Abacha.

Mr Abubakar Malami (SAN), the Attorney-General of the Federation and Minister of Justice, signed on behalf of Nigeria while the Swiss Foreign Affairs Minister, Mr Didier Burkhalter, signed for his home country.

A brief discussion between Vice-President Yemi Osinbajo and Burkhalter preceded the event which took place at the vice president’s conference room with Swiss Ambassador Eric Mayoraz and his Chief of Staff, Damien Cottier in attendance as witnesses.

The Swiss minister told State House correspondents at the end of the ceremony that the event was a milestone in the effort to complete the return of the late Abacha’s illegally acquired funds stashed in his country.

Burkhalter said: “We are confident that we can work together in order tomake a new point and step in fighting corruption.

“The fight against corruption is a priority of our government and it is important to work together in order to restitute the money that has been stolen to the population.

“Switzerland and Nigeria have already written the history 10 years ago with the restitution of 700 milliondollars of the Abacha funds.

“Today, it is another amount of 321 million dollars that can be restituted.“We are at the end of the process butit is very important now to make everything right and above all to organise a monitoring mechanism by the World Bank for the use of these stolen assets.

“And then, there will be a restitution and it will be and can be swift, transparent and can be at the end forthe good of the population.”

According to Burkhalter, it is important to show a common will by Nigeria and Switzerland by the signing of this letter of intent to go that way and to move ahead.

He said that there was a legal requirement in the decision of the prosecutor in Switzerland to ensure judicious use of the money when repatriated.“There is the necessity of a monitoring mechanism by the World Bank and it is also necessary to have good projects in social way.

“For instance, there could be the initiative to save one million lives.“If we have this mechanism by the World Bank for monitoring and the good project to the good of the population, then the money will be restituted.”

Burkhalter said he was not aware of any other funds illegally kept in his country besides the Abacha loot.In his remarks, Malami said the essence of the signing was to communicate to the world and Nigerians.

Malami said, “The intendment arising from the signing of the letter of intent is to communicate to the world and the Nigerian state in this regard, that the intention is there andthe commitment is there and the fund is going to be repatriated as quickly and as soon as possible.”

On the significance of the event, Malami said it was to send a clear message to the people that the Buhari administration was working hard to recover all looted funds.“

The message is clear that this government is up and doing as far as the repatriation of looted funds wherever they are located, wherever they are situated in the globe is concerned.

“The government has the desired commitment, has the desired political will, has the desired cooperation and has put in place the desired road map for the recovery of the looted fund,” he added. (NAN)

Oil Recovers As It Is Now $40 Per Barrel, The Highest Since December

The oil price has hit $40 for the first time since December after extending gains that have seen it recover from a sharp downturn.

Hopes of an improving global outlook and stronger sentiment for a recovery in turbulent markets saw the price of a barrel of Brent crude rise to $40 on Monday, the highest level for nearly three months - before edging slightly lower again.

Brent crude had tumbled close to $27 in January, its lowest level since 2003, amid a glut in oil supply and slowing world demand as the global economy stuttered.

The fall left it more than three quarters off its peak at more than $115 in the summer of 2014 and was accompanied by a turbulent period in stock markets.

Low oil prices have helped consumers by driving down the cost of petrol.

But energy companies and the suppliers and contractors they work with have been badly affected with thousands of jobs axed globally, including many in the North Sea.Oil has turned higher more recently and was up again in latest trading, partly drivenby a rally in Asian markets.

The crude price improvement was also helped by US energy firms cutting back thenumber of oil rigs in operation.However some analysts warned that the glut of oil could continue to drag on the price.
